NJ Employment Lawyers, LLC represents employees in Brigantine, NJ in a wide range of employment disputes under New Jersey and federal law. We provide legal counsel and representation in the following areas:
Discrimination & Harassment
- Workplace Discrimination
Legal representation in cases involving discrimination based on race, gender, age, religion, national origin, disability, sexual orientation, or any other protected status. We pursue claims under federal and state anti-discrimination statutes. - Sexual Harassment
Advocacy for employees subjected to unwelcome conduct, inappropriate comments, or physical harassment. We also litigate retaliation claims when employers discipline or terminate workers for reporting misconduct. - Hostile Work Environment
Legal action in situations where repeated or severe discriminatory conduct makes it difficult for employees to perform their job or continue employment. - Pregnancy and Caregiver Discrimination
Claims involving adverse employment actions due to pregnancy, childbirth recovery, or caregiving responsibilities for family members. - Medical Condition Discrimination
Representation for workers facing bias based on chronic illnesses, HIV status, or other health-related conditions. - Appearance-Based Discrimination
Cases involving hairstyle or grooming bias under the CROWN Act, which protects cultural and ethnic expressions in the workplace. - Marital or Family Status Discrimination
Claims related to differential treatment based on relationship status or family structure. - Military or Veteran Status Discrimination
Legal protection for current or former service members denied fair treatment in hiring, promotions, or job security.
